The PowerStep ProTech CustomPost® full length insoles have a unique design with a customizable shell that allows for quick and simple adjustments of either heel posts (neutral 0°, 2° or 4°) or heel lifts (1/8” or 1/4" heights). The snap-on heel posts are designed to align the heel and stabilize the foot during ambulation to limit overpronation or supination, helping with varus or valgus ankle correction. The snap-on heel lifts add additional height for leg length discrepancy. The ProTech CustomPost full length orthotic insoles are a medical-grade foot support with built-in neutral arch and dual-layer cushioning that are the perfect balance of comfort and support. The ProTech CustomPost insoles feature the signature PowerStep arch shape that cradles the arch and heel, adding stability and motion control to limit excess stress on feet, ankles, joints, and tendons. While the orthotic shell supports the foot, the combination of the heel posts or heel lifts improves overall foot function and alignment. BENEFITS The ProTech CustomPost insoles feature an odor control top fabric that helps control heat, friction, and perspiration. The cushioning layer is made up of energy activating ShockAbsorb Premium Foam. Below the premium foam cushion layer is an EVA foam cushioning cover for maximum comfort. Following the dual-layer cushioning is a firm but flexible external neutral arch support shell and heel cradle for improved motion control. The arch support shell includes an angled platform that allows the heel posts or heel lifts to be added to the insoles. Neutral arches need stable, yet flexible arch support for shock absorption and proper alignment. Leg length discrepancy and varus/valgus ankle need additional customization that the heel posts and heel lifts can deliver. Overpronation can cause: Plantar Fasciitis; Achilles Tendonitis; Metatarsalgia; Morton's Neuroma; Arch heel pain; Ankle, knee, hip back pain; Shin splints; Bunions; Heel spurs; Hammer claw toes; Calluses corns Mild to moderate pronation can cause: Plantar Fasciitis; Achilles Tendonitis; Arch heel pain; Ankle, knee, hip back pain; Shin splints; Bunions; Heel spurs; Hammer claw toes; Calluses corns Supination can cause: Plantar Fasciitis; Achilles Tendonitis; Fat pad atrophy; Morton's Neuroma; Arch heel pain; Ball of foot pain; Ankle, knee, hip back pain; Shin splints; Stress fractures in the feet legs; Bunions; Heel spurs; Hammer claw toes; Calluses corns SPECIFICATIONS Top Cover: Odor control polyester top fabric, black Dual Layer Cushioning: ShockAbsorb™ Premium Foam top layer, royal blue; EVA base, red Arch: Firm but flexible external polypropylene support shell with angled heel platform for snap-on heel posts or heel lifts, royal blue Heel Posts: Polypropylene snap-on heel posts Neutral 0°, red 2°, blue 4°, gray Heel Lifts: Polypropylene snap-on heel lifts 1/8", ivory 1/4", black Shoe Sizes: Available in 8 sizes ranging from Men's U.S. shoe sizes 4 to 15, and Women's U.S. shoe sizes 6 to 12 Packaging Contains: 1 pair of insoles; 1 pair each of 0°, 2° and 4° heel posts; 1 pair each of 1/8" and 1/4" heel lifts Ideal shoe type: Intended for footwear where the factory insoles can be removed and designed for shoes such as Athletic (Walking/Running), Work, Casual Dress Shoes Proper care: Spot clean with mild detergent. Do not immerse in water. Air dry. Covered under US Patent #7,913,429 PowerStep insoles should last 6 months or longer depending on wear usage and activity level. Need more information?
